| #!/usr/bin/env python3 | |
| """ | |
| Push Zenith-7B model to Hugging Face Hub. | |
| Usage: | |
| python push_to_hf.py --repo_id Matrix-Corp/Zenith-7b-V1 --token YOUR_TOKEN | |
| """ | |
| import argparse | |
| import os | |
| import sys | |
| from pathlib import Path | |
| from huggingface_hub import HfApi, login, create_repo, whoami | |
| from huggingface_hub.utils import RepositoryNotFoundError, HfHubHTTPError | |
| def push_model(repo_id: str, token: str = None, folder_path: str = ".", private: bool = False): | |
| """Push model files to Hugging Face Hub with robust error handling.""" | |
| folder_path = Path(folder_path).resolve() | |
| if not folder_path.exists(): | |
| raise ValueError(f"Folder not found: {folder_path}") | |
| # Check required files | |
| required_files = [ | |
| "modeling_zenith.py", | |
| "hf_model_card.md", | |
| "README.md", | |
| "requirements.txt", | |
| "train.py", | |
| "inference.py", | |
| "test_model.py", | |
| "finetune_qwen.py", | |
| "Modelfile" | |
| ] | |
| missing = [f for f in required_files if not (folder_path / f).exists()] | |
| if missing: | |
| print(f"⚠️ Warning: Missing files: {missing}") | |
| response = input("Continue anyway? (y/N): ") | |
| if response.lower() != 'y': | |
| return | |
| # Authenticate | |
| try: | |
| if token: | |
| login(token=token) | |
| print("✓ Logged in with provided token") | |
| else: | |
| # Check if already logged in | |
| try: | |
| user = whoami() | |
| print(f"✓ Already logged in as: {user['name']}") | |
| except: | |
| print("Please login to Hugging Face:") | |
| login() | |
| except Exception as e: | |
| print(f"❌ Authentication failed: {e}") | |
| print("\nTo get a token:") | |
| print("1. Go to https://huggingface.co/settings/tokens") | |
| print("2. Create a new token with 'write' permissions") | |
| print("3. Run: python push_to_hf.py --token YOUR_TOKEN") | |
| return | |
| # Create API client | |
| api = HfApi() | |
| # Check if repo exists, create if not | |
| try: | |
| repo_info = api.repo_info(repo_id=repo_id, repo_type="model") | |
| print(f"✓ Repository exists: {repo_id}") | |
| except RepositoryNotFoundError: | |
| print(f"📝 Repository not found. Creating: {repo_id}") | |
| try: | |
| create_repo( | |
| repo_id=repo_id, | |
| token=token, | |
| repo_type="model", | |
| private=private, | |
| exist_ok=True | |
| ) | |
| print(f"✓ Repository created") | |
| except Exception as e: | |
| print(f"❌ Failed to create repository: {e}") | |
| return | |
| except Exception as e: | |
| print(f"⚠️ Warning: Could not check repository: {e}") | |
| # Upload | |
| print(f"\n📤 Uploading {folder_path} to {repo_id}...") | |
| print("This may take a while depending on file sizes...\n") | |
| try: | |
| api.upload_folder( | |
| folder_path=str(folder_path), | |
| repo_id=repo_id, | |
| repo_type="model", | |
| commit_message=f"Upload Zenith-7B model" | |
| ) | |
| print(f"\n✅ Successfully uploaded to https://huggingface.co/{repo_id}") | |
| print("\nNext steps:") | |
| print("1. Visit your model page") | |
| print("2. Add a model card if needed") | |
| print("3. Test: from transformers import AutoModel; AutoModel.from_pretrained('your-repo-id')") | |
| except HfHubHTTPError as e: | |
| if e.response.status_code == 401: | |
| print(f"\n❌ Unauthorized: Invalid token or no write access") | |
| print(" Make sure you:") | |
| print(" - Have a valid token with 'write' permissions") | |
| print(" - Own the organization/repository or have collaborator rights") | |
| elif e.response.status_code == 403: | |
| print(f"\n❌ Forbidden: You don't have permission to push to this repository") | |
| print(" Make sure you're a member of the organization with write access") | |
| elif e.response.status_code == 404: | |
| print(f"\n❌ Repository not found: {repo_id}") | |
| print(" Check the repository ID is correct") | |
| else: | |
| print(f"\n❌ HTTP Error {e.response.status_code}: {e}") | |
| except Exception as e: | |
| print(f"\n❌ Upload failed: {e}") | |
| print("\nTroubleshooting:") | |
| print("1. Check your internet connection") | |
| print("2. Verify you have enough disk space") | |
| print("3. Try logging in again: huggingface-cli login") | |
| print("4. Check Hugging Face status: https://status.huggingface.co") | |
| def main(): | |
| parser = argparse.ArgumentParser(description="Push Zenith-7B to Hugging Face") | |
| parser.add_argument( | |
| "--repo_id", | |
| type=str, | |
| default="Matrix-Corp/Zenith-7b-V1", | |
| help="Hugging Face repository ID (username/model-name)" | |
| ) | |
| parser.add_argument( | |
| "--token", | |
| type=str, | |
| help="Hugging Face access token (optional if already logged in)" | |
| ) | |
| parser.add_argument( | |
| "--folder", | |
| type=str, | |
| default=".", | |
| help="Folder containing model files (default: current directory)" | |
| ) | |
| parser.add_argument( | |
| "--private", | |
| action="store_true", | |
| help="Create repository as private (default: public)" | |
| ) | |
| args = parser.parse_args() | |
| push_model(args.repo_id, args.token, args.folder, args.private) | |
| if __name__ == "__main__": | |
| main() | |
